Blockchain technology has gained significant attention in recent years due to its revolutionary potential across various industries. Alongside blockchain, there are several similar software technologies that leverage decentralized systems to provide innovative solutions. In this blog post, we will explore some of the key blockchain-like software technologies that are making waves in the tech world.

1. Distributed Ledger Technology (DLT): Distributed Ledger Technology (DLT) is a type of decentralized database that is distributed across multiple nodes or locations. Similar to blockchain, DLT facilitates secure and transparent record-keeping without the need for a central authority. DLT is being utilized in various applications such as supply chain management, healthcare records, and voting systems. 2. Hashgraph: Hashgraph is a consensus algorithm and data structure that offers a more efficient and secure alternative to traditional blockchain technology. Unlike blockchain, Hashgraph does not require proof-of-work mining, making it faster and more scalable. Hashgraph is being explored for applications in finance, gaming, and decentralized identity management. 3. Holochain: Holochain is a framework for building decentralized applications (dApps) that operate without central servers. Holochain utilizes a distributed hash table (DHT) for data storage and validation, enabling peer-to-peer interactions without the need for a global consensus mechanism. Holochain is gaining traction in areas such as social networking, collaborative workspaces, and decentralized finance. 4. IPFS (InterPlanetary File System): IPFS is a peer-to-peer protocol for storing and sharing hypermedia in a distributed file system. IPFS allows users to access content based on its unique hash, making it resistant to censorship and single points of failure. IPFS is being used for content delivery, data sharing, and decentralized web applications. 5. Tangle (IOTA): Tangle is a directed acyclic graph (DAG) technology that serves as the underlying architecture for the IOTA cryptocurrency. Tangle enables fee-less transactions and high scalability by requiring users to validate previous transactions as they submit new ones. Tangle is being explored for applications in the Internet of Things (IoT), machine-to-machine communication, and micropayments. In conclusion, while blockchain technology has been at the forefront of the decentralized revolution, there are several other similar software technologies that offer unique advantages and use cases. From DLT and Hashgraph to Holochain, IPFS, and Tangle, these technologies are pushing the boundaries of what is possible in the decentralized ecosystem. As these technologies continue to evolve and mature, we can expect to see even more innovative applications and opportunities emerge in the near future.
